Version Text
Hebrew אם־אלך בקרב צרה תחיני על אף איבי תשלח ידך ותושיעני ימינך׃
Greek εαν πορευθω εν μεσω θλιψεως ζησεις με επ' οργην εχθρων μου εξετεινας χειρα σου και εσωσεν με η δεξια
Latin Si ambulavero in medio tribulationis, vivificabis me ; et super iram inimicorum meorum extendisti manum tuam, et salvum me fecit dextera tua.
KJV Though I walk in the midst of trouble, thou wilt revive me: thou shalt stretch forth thine hand against the wrath of mine enemies, and thy right hand shall save me.
WEB Though I walk in the midst of trouble, you will revive me. You will stretch forth your hand against the wrath of my enemies. Your right hand will save me.
